In Hong Kong, children from low-income families have limited access to sports opportunities, hindering their ability to explore and develop both physically and socially. Many of these children possess untapped potential in various sports that could flourish with the right support.

Sports Teams and Leagues
Establishing community sports leagues for children of all skill levels. These leagues provide regular opportunities for children to play and compete in a supportive environment, helping them build friendships and confidence.

Family Sports and Fun Days
Creating vibrant family-oriented sports days featuring competitions in various sports promotes family unity and teamwork. Families can participate together, strengthening bonds while encouraging physical activity and fostering a spirit of joy and camaraderie.

Movement and Workshops
Offering workshops that teach children the importance of fitness and exercise helps them understand the various benefits, including improved coordination and boosted confidence. Encouraging resilience and the mindset to keep trying, fostering a lifelong love of movement.
